If you want to use the wifi and browsing capabilities, then it's a much better value option than a regular iPod. If you want to listen to a lot of music or watch a lot of video and capacity is a concern, then an iPod classic is a much better value proposition.

If you want a touch screen device, the Samsung YP-P2 is on Amazon for about £120 (8gb version). Far cheaper than the iPod.
It's drag and droppable, or you can use it as a media device in WMP etc... I prefer the former.
It supports all the usual formats, along with Ogg (for open source fans like myself). It also supports avi's. Well a trimmed avi's, Samsung like to call it an svi, but it's basically an avi, without the b-frames and resized to a set resolution.
I've got one. It's great. The screen is 1/2 an inch smaller than a Touch but that doesn't bother me too much. It plays music well, and videos are good to watch on it. And it only cost me £120, not £200. There's a 16gb version due soon too."Boonowa tweepi, ha, ha."0 -
